Теми рефератів
> Реферати > Курсові роботи > Звіти з практики > Курсові проекти > Питання та відповіді > Ессе > Доклади > Учбові матеріали > Контрольні роботи > Методички > Лекції > Твори > Підручники > Статті Контакти
Реферати, твори, дипломи, практика » Новые рефераты » Розробка WEB-системи комерційного доступу до мережі Internet на базі операційної системи FreeBSD

Реферат Розробка WEB-системи комерційного доступу до мережі Internet на базі операційної системи FreeBSD





> Контроль процедур тестування

Незалежність ПО від тестування. Тобто ПО не повинно перебудовуватися особливим чином під тести

Тестування повинне кілька разів покривати вихідний код, для виявлення певного класу помилок

Робастное тестування

Тестування на предмет непрямого виявлення помилок. Наприклад: відповідність стандартам розробки ПЗ.

Для перевірки правильної роботи сайт було вирішено протестувати і перевірити за наступними пунктами:

· безпеку системи (перевірка системи на стійкість до спроб злому);

· відпрацювання неприпустимих операцій (висновок помилки при неприпустимому дії), наприклад набір неіснуючих даних користувачем або вчинення неправильних дій;

· перевірка коректної роботи модулів. Тестування модулів окремо і незалежно;

· тестування модулів у складі системи в цілому. Тестування системи після запуску сайту в Інтернеті. Перевірка взаємодії між модулями і цілісності системи.


4.1 Розробка тестів


Для перевірки правильної роботи системи було вирішено протестувати і перевірити за наступними пунктами:

· Безпека системи (перевірка системи на стійкість до спроб злому).

· Відпрацювання неприпустимих операцій (висновок помилки при неприпустимому дії), наприклад набір неправильних даних.

· Перевірка коректної роботи модулів. Тестування модулів окремо і незалежно.

· Тестування модулів у складі системи в цілому. Перевірка взаємодії між модулями і цілісності системи.

4.2 Тестування системи


«Тестування програм може використовуватися для демонстрації наявності помилок, але воно ніколи не покаже їх відсутність»- Дейкстра, 1970 р. [1]

Тестування роботи програмного забезпечення є невід'ємною частиною розробки всіх програмних систем.

Тестові випробування CMS системи вироблялися як при розробці окремих складових систему класів, так і на етапі інтеграції класів і різних модулів системи.

При введення неприпустимих даних система видає відповідні помилки, такі як повідомлення про неправильному введенні логіна і пароля, що не правильному заповнення полів форми даних.

Під час тестування були знайдені не значні помилки, які були згодом усунені. Перевірка в нормальних умовах показала, що система працює коректно. Для перевірки коректності роботи системи, вводилися неприпустимі значення або помилкові.


Висновок


Результати дипломної роботи можна сформулювати у вигляді наступних висновків:

· Проведено огляд та аналіз систем-аналогів

· Вивчено предметна область

· Обгрунтовано актуальність системи

· Розглянуто методи та вирішення поставленого завдання

· Проведено проектування функціональної структури системи з використанням CASE - засобів

· Розроблено систему комерційного доступу до мережі

· Розро...


Назад | сторінка 33 з 37 | Наступна сторінка





Схожі реферати:

  • Реферат на тему: Розробка захищеної системи тестування з використанням WEB-програмування
  • Реферат на тему: Проектування і розробка мережевої системи тестування студентів
  • Реферат на тему: Розробка захищеної системи тестування
  • Реферат на тему: Розробка Автоматизованої системи тестування студентов
  • Реферат на тему: Проектування системи тестування знань учнів